California to Ban Public Schools From Naming Sports Teams 'Redskins': 'We Have Taken a Stand Against This Insidious Slur'
California will ban public schools from naming their sports teams "Redskins," a name seen as a slur against Native Americans, but will not stop municipalities from naming parks and buildings for Confederate heroes, Governor Jerry Brown said on Sunday.

California Gov. Vetoes Bill Mandating Campus Sexual Assault Sanctions
California Governor Jerry Brown on Sunday vetoed a bill that would have required most public and private colleges in the state to expel or suspend for a minimum of two years students found to have violated certain campus sexual assault policies.

Controversial Right-to-Die Bill Inspired by Brittany Maynard Signed Into Law In California
Physician-assisted suicide will become legal in California under a bill signed into law on Monday by Democratic Governor Jerry Brown, despite intense opposition from some religious and disability rights groups.
